How does the shopping day work?
When you check in for your shopping appointment, you will be asked for
your student I.D. or drivers license.
After checking in your purse or backpack, you and one guest will be
escorted into the shopping area.  
You will have one hour to find the prom outfit of your dreams, plus all
the accessories to go with it!  
Our personal shoppers and volunteers will be on hand to help you make
your selections, try on your outfit, even pick your jewelry and
accessories.  
Once you've found everything you need, you will check out and be ready
for a fabulous night!

Are high school students the only people you help?
We provide assistance to students of all ages and formals for all
occasions, including military balls, debutant parties, and 8th grade
dances.  Students applying for activities other than prom should still fill
out the
application and make note of the event they are attending.  
Acceptances will be made for students not attending a prom on a
case-by-case basis, depending upon how many applications and donations
we receive year to year.

What does FGP do year-round?
Our busiest months are January through March as we are preparing for
the Shopping Day.  We receive the bulk of our donations during these
months.  We plan for the shopping day for 9 months and in that time also
organize donation drives, plan fundraising events, and constantly receive
and sort through donations.  We have many opportunities to plan and
serve on committees.  If you are interested, please
let us know.
